Specialized Terminology
Performance Metrics and Specifications
Precise translation of automotive measurements:
Horsepower vs. PS: Japanese PS (metric horsepower) vs. American horsepower conversionTorque Specifications: Newton-meters vs. foot-pounds conversion and applicationDisplacement Units: Liters vs. cubic inches, metric vs. imperial measurementsPressure Ratings: PSI, bar, and kPa conversions for boost and tire pressureTemperature Ranges: Celsius vs. Fahrenheit for operating specificationsJapanese Automotive Terms

Pre-Show Translation Rates
Marketing and Technical Materials
Comprehensive pre-show translation pricing:
Product Catalogs: $0.35-0.50 per word (technical automotive specifications)Installation Manuals: $0.40-0.55 per word (safety-critical instructions)Marketing Materials: $0.30-0.45 per word (consumer-facing content)Regulatory Documentation: $0.45-0.65 per word (compliance requirements)Website Localization: $0.38-0.53 per word (e-commerce and technical content)Rush Pre-Show Services
Expedited delivery for tight SEMA deadlines:
One-week delivery: 50% surchargeThree-day delivery: 75% surchargeSame-day delivery: 100% surchargeHoliday/weekend work: Additional 50% premiumOn-Site SEMA Interpretation
Trade Show Floor Services
Professional interpretation during SEMA Show:
Booth interpretation: $200-350 per hour (automotive technical expertise)Business meetings: $250-400 per hour (partnership negotiations)Media interviews: $300-450 per hour (public relations expertise)Technical training: $225-375 per hour (hands-on automotive instruction)Daily and Multi-Day Packages
Comprehensive SEMA Show interpretation coverage:
Full-day coverage: $1,800-2,800 per interpreter (10-hour days)Multi-day packages: $7,500-12,000 per interpreter (4-day SEMA coverage)Team assignments: 15% discount for 2+ interpretersEquipment rental: $300-600 per day (wireless systems, booths)ROI of SEMA Translation Investment
